Career Choices Dewis Gyrfa Ltd is seeking a compassionate Kitchen Assistant in Oswestry to play a vital role in our care homes. You'll assist in meal preparation and serve nutritious meals, ensuring residents' comfort and dignity are prioritized.
Candidates should have kitchen experience and a passion for helping others. An NVQ2 in Catering or a willingness to obtain it is essential.
Enjoy benefits such as paid training, company pension scheme, and access to discounts.
